Some of the richest people of the 21st century own a huge virtual reality environment: The Otherland Network. It took several generations and an enormous budget to build it. Nevertheless there are things happening in this simulation that were not planned and can not be controlled. On the other hand, children all over the world fall into a deep coma after beeing somewhere on the net. Is there a connection between these kids and otherland? The young female african Renie and her friend !Xabbu, one of the last bushmen, start exploring the riddle. They don't know that several other people are working on the same problem. This is a story! It evolves over the four volumes and you have to read them all in a row. Actually there at least eight different stories that evolve parallel, cross and go into different directions. As some of these stories take place in real life, other in a virtual reality and some of them hop from one to the other. At many times it reminded me at Tolkiens "Lord of the rings", despite this is a piece of science fiction and not fantasy. The characters are very interesting and it is hard to put the book away. Just the end is a bit weird and this made nine instead of ten points. Nevertheless, this were more than 3000 pages that I will not forget.
